With the aim of producing players from the school level, 32 schools are going to participate in the 2nd SEE Cup inter-maverick football in Sunsari.

He said in a press conference that 32 schools from Morang and Sunsari will participate in the competition organized by Sky Football Academy in Barah Kshetra 3 of Sunsari.

Nadi Rai, guardian of the academy and football coach, said that only students who have passed SEE will be allowed to play in the three-week competition.

The president of the academy, Suman Karki, said that the winner will get 30,000 and the runner-up will get 15,000. The best player will get 100% scholarship for class 11th and 12th. 75% scholarship will be awarded to the category best and 50% scholarship to the man of the match.
